Answer:

43.18%

Explanation:

To calculate the percentage by mass of oxygen in the compound, multiply the atomic mass of oxygen by two. This is done because the compound contains two moles of oxygen.

16*2=32

32 divided by the formula mass as given in the question multiplied by 100 gives 43.18%
